在当今数字化办公环境中,Excel 和数据库的结合成为了很多企业提升数据处理效率的关键选择。尤其是对于需要将 Excel 表格与 Sybase 数据库进行对接的用户而言,掌握正确的操作步骤不仅能简化数据流转,也能避免重复劳动和数据错误。那么,excel如何链接sybase数据库?新手也能学会的详细操作步骤,到底应该从哪里入手?本节将为你逐步解答,从基础知识到环境准备,帮你打好坚实的技术底层。

一、excel如何链接sybase数据库?基础知识与环境准备
1、认识 Sybase 数据库与 Excel 的连接原理
Sybase 数据库是一款功能强大的关系型数据库系统,广泛应用于金融、电信等行业。Excel 则以其简便易用的表格操作和数据分析能力,成为了数据处理的常青工具。将 Excel 连接至 Sybase 数据库的本质,是利用 Excel 的外部数据源功能,通过 ODBC(开放数据库连接)驱动,实现数据的查询和同步。
- ODBC(Open Database Connectivity): 微软提出的一种数据库通用访问接口,使应用程序可以通过统一方式访问不同类型数据库。
- Excel 外部数据源功能: 支持通过 ODBC、OLE DB 等接口,连接多种数据库,导入或查询数据。
这种连接方式不仅可以让 Excel 直接读取 Sybase 表的数据,还能进行数据的更新和分析,极大提升了业务处理的灵活性和效率。🚀
2、准备工作一览表
在正式操作前,建议先确认以下准备事项:
| 步骤 | 详情说明 | 是否必需 |
|---|---|---|
| 安装 Sybase 数据库 | 有现成数据库服务器或本地安装 | 必需 |
| 获取连接信息 | 包含服务器地址、端口、用户名密码 | 必需 |
| 安装 ODBC 驱动 | Sybase 专用 ODBC 驱动 | 必需 |
| Excel 已安装 | 推荐使用 Office 2016 及以上 | 必需 |
| 系统权限 | 管理员权限安装驱动、配置连接 | 建议 |
从上表可见,最关键的环节是确保 ODBC 驱动和数据库连接信息的准确。驱动的不同版本、数据库端口的设置,都可能影响最终的连接效果。
3、Sybase ODBC 驱动获取与安装注意事项
Sybase 的 ODBC 驱动一般可从 SAP 官网或第三方渠道下载。安装过程中注意以下要点:
- 选择合适的驱动版本: 根据你的操作系统(32位/64位)和 Excel 版本选择匹配的驱动。
- 安装路径记录: 驱动安装后,会在控制面板的“ODBC 数据源管理器”中出现,便于后续配置。
- 权限要求: 部分驱动需要管理员权限安装,否则将无法在 Excel 中正常调用。
实用建议: 如遇驱动安装失败,优先检查操作系统兼容性和安装包完整性。如有企业 IT 部门支持,可寻求技术协助。👍
4、Excel 与 Sybase 的连接方式对比
很多用户会问,Excel 能否通过其他方式连接 Sybase?实操中,主流方式为 ODBC 连接,OLE DB 方式次之。下面用表格做简单对比:
| 连接方式 | 优点 | 缺点 |
|---|---|---|
| ODBC | 稳定、兼容强 | 驱动需单独安装 |
| OLE DB | 支持部分高级功能 | 兼容性较差 |
| VBA 编程 | 灵活可定制 | 需一定开发基础 |
对于“新手也能学会的详细操作步骤”,推荐采用 ODBC 连接法,步骤清晰、易于排查问题。
5、Excel 与 Sybase 连接应用场景
掌握 Excel 连接 Sybase 数据库,不仅能简化财务报表、库存管理等日常数据汇总,还能实现:
- 自动化数据分析
- 批量数据同步与更新
- 数据可视化展示
如果你的团队已经在使用 Excel 进行数据填报、审批等业务流,连接 Sybase 后将大幅提升数据处理的效率和准确性。
二、excel如何链接sybase数据库?新手也能学会的详细操作步骤
本节将以通俗易懂的方式,详细讲解 Excel 连接 Sybase 数据库的完整操作流程,让新手也能轻松上手。你只需跟着步骤操作,无需专业 IT 背景,也能顺利完成数据对接。
1、配置 Sybase ODBC 数据源
首先,你需要在 Windows 系统中配置 Sybase 的 ODBC 数据源,让 Excel 能够识别并连接数据库。
具体步骤如下:
- 打开“控制面板” → “管理工具” → “ODBC 数据源(32位/64位)”;
- 点击“系统 DSN”或“用户 DSN”标签页,选择“添加”;
- 在列表中找到并选择“Sybase ODBC 驱动”;
- 配置数据源名称(如 SYBASE_TEST)、服务器地址、端口、用户名、密码等信息;
- 测试连接,确保能成功连接到数据库。
常见问题与解决方案:
- 如驱动列表无 Sybase 选项,需重新安装驱动;
- 连接失败多因信息填写错误或网络不通,可通过 ping 服务器地址确认;
- 权限不足导致无法保存设置,请使用管理员账户操作。
2、Excel 中导入 Sybase 数据库数据
完成 ODBC 数据源配置后,Excel 就可以直接连接 Sybase,导入数据了。
操作流程如下:
- 打开 Excel,选择“数据”菜单;
- 点击“自其他源获取数据”或“从数据库导入内容”,选择“来自 ODBC”;
- 在弹出的对话框中,选择刚刚配置好的 Sybase 数据源(如 SYBASE_TEST);
- 输入数据库用户名和密码,点击“连接”;
- 选择需要导入的表或视图,支持筛选、预览数据;
- 点击“加载”或“导入”,即可将数据导入到 Excel 工作表。
实用技巧:
- 可选择只导入部分字段,减少无用数据;
- 可设置数据刷新周期,实现自动更新;
- 支持数据透视表、图表等进一步分析。
案例展示
假设你有一个 Sybase 数据库,存储着公司的销售订单信息,表名为 sales_order。你可以在 Excel 中按如下步骤快速导入数据:
- 配置 ODBC 数据源,命名为 SALES_DB;
- 在 Excel 中选择 SALES_DB 连接,输入数据库账号密码;
- 选择 sales_order 表,导入所有字段;
- 利用 Excel 的数据透视表,统计不同地区的销售额。
从此,销售数据分析再也不用手工导出,轻松实现自动化!🎉
3、Excel 与 Sybase 的数据同步与更新
除了数据导入,很多用户关心 Excel 是否能直接修改 Sybase 数据库内容。答案是:可以,但需谨慎操作。
- 在使用 Excel 查询 Sybase 数据时,部分版本支持“可编辑查询”,直接在 Excel 表格中修改数据后同步回数据库。
- 推荐使用“Microsoft Query”工具,连接 ODBC 数据源后,选择支持的数据表,勾选“返回可编辑数据”。
- 修改数据后,点击“保存”或“提交”,数据即可同步回 Sybase 数据库。
注意事项:
- 数据同步有权限要求,需数据库账号有写入权限;
- 建议只对小批量数据进行修改,大批量操作建议在数据库端完成;
- 数据同步前建议备份,避免误操作造成损失。
4、常见报错及处理方法
实际操作过程中,Excel 连接 Sybase 常见报错有:
- 驱动未安装:请确认 ODBC 驱动已正确安装,建议重新安装或更新版本;
- 连接信息错误:检查服务器地址、端口、账号密码是否正确;
- 权限不足:联系数据库管理员开通读写权限;
- 数据库网络不通:确认本地与数据库服务器网络畅通,可用 ping 命令测试;
- 数据格式异常:部分 Sybase 字段类型需在 Excel 导入时进行转换,如日期、金额字段。
处理建议:
- 每步操作后及时测试连接,发现问题立刻回溯;
- 对照错误提示逐项排查,避免盲目重试;
- 多做笔记,总结常见问题与解决方案。
三、excel如何链接sybase数据库?进阶技巧与效率提升建议
当你掌握了 Excel 基础连接 Sybase 数据库的操作后,进一步提升数据处理效率就变得尤为重要。本节将从进阶技巧、常见优化手段、替代方案等角度,帮助你构建更高效的数据工作流。
1、批量数据处理与自动化
Excel 支持通过 Power Query、VBA 等方式,实现批量数据导入和自动化处理。
- 利用 Power Query,可以设置数据刷新周期,每隔一定时间自动更新 Sybase 数据;
- 通过 VBA 脚本,实现复杂的数据查询和写入逻辑,满足自定义业务需求;
- 对于定期报表、库存监控等场景,自动化功能大幅减少人工操作,提升准确性。
实用场景举例:
- 每天自动拉取最新订单数据,生成销售报表;
- 定期同步库存信息,自动生成采购建议;
- 自动统计客户反馈,辅助业务决策。
2、数据安全与权限管理
连接 Sybase 数据库时,一定要重视数据安全与权限管控:
- 数据库账号尽量只分配必要的查询权限,避免泄漏敏感数据;
- Excel 工作簿可设置访问密码,防止数据被非授权用户查看或修改;
- 定期更换数据库账号密码,降低安全风险;
- 数据同步操作前务必备份,防止误操作导致数据丢失。
安全建议:
- 企业内部建议由 IT 部门统一分配数据库访问权限;
- 对重要数据操作,建议采用双人复核机制。
3、替代方案推荐——简道云,让数据管理更高效 🚀
虽然 Excel 连接 Sybase 数据库很实用,但在实际业务流中,在线协作、流程审批、数据填报等需求日益增长。此时,推荐一款能替代 Excel 的高效数据平台——简道云。
- 简道云是 IDC 认证国内市场占有率第一的零代码数字化平台,拥有 2000w+ 用户、200w+ 团队使用。
- 支持无需代码即可搭建在线数据填报、流程审批、数据统计分析等业务场景;
- 可与主流数据库对接,实现数据自动同步与实时分析;
- 多人在线协作,权限管理灵活,极大提升团队效率;
- 支持移动端操作,无论在办公室还是出差途中都能轻松管理数据。
简道云让你的数据管理更高效、更安全、更智能,是 Excel 的理想替代方案。强烈建议体验: 简道云在线试用:www.jiandaoyun.com
4、表格总结:Excel 与 Sybase 连接 vs 简道云数据管理
| 方案 | 优点 | 缺点 | 推荐场景 |
|---|---|---|---|
| Excel+Sybase | 简单易用,支持数据分析 | 协作性差、权限管理弱 | 个人/小团队 |
| 简道云 | 在线协作、流程审批、数据填报 | 需注册账号 | 企业/团队 |
无论你选择哪种方式,关键在于找到最适合自己和团队的解决方案。
四、总结与简道云推荐
本文系统梳理了excel如何链接sybase数据库?新手也能学会的详细操作步骤,从基础环境准备到详细操作流程,再到进阶效率提升建议与替代方案推荐,全面覆盖了新手用户的实际需求。只要按照文中步骤,配置好 ODBC 数据源,掌握 Excel 导入与同步技巧,即使没有专业技术背景,也能轻松实现 Excel 与 Sybase 数据库的高效对接。
同时,针对数据协作、流程审批等复杂业务场景,推荐大家尝试简道云。作为 IDC 认证市场占有率第一的零代码平台,简道云能帮你更高效地进行在线数据管理、统计分析,2000w+ 用户与 200w+ 团队已经用行动证明了它的高效与易用。想要体验更智能的数据管理方式,欢迎试用: 简道云在线试用:www.jiandaoyun.com
无论是 Excel 还是简道云,都能为你的数字化办公提供强有力的支持,选择适合自己的工具,就是提升工作效率的第一步!
本文相关FAQs
1. Excel链接Sybase数据库时需要用什么驱动?怎么判断自己电脑上有没有?
很多人在尝试让Excel连接Sybase数据库的时候,会卡在“驱动”这一步。不是很清楚到底需要安装哪个驱动,也不了解怎么确定自己的电脑已经具备连接条件。有没有什么办法能快速判断一下,少走弯路?
你好,关于Excel连接Sybase数据库的驱动问题,我之前也踩过不少坑,给大家分享下我的经验:
- 要想让Excel和Sybase打通,最常用的是ODBC驱动(Open Database Connectivity)。Sybase官方有提供自己的ODBC驱动,也有第三方的,比如“Adaptive Server Enterprise ODBC Driver”。
- 判断电脑是否安装了Sybase ODBC驱动,最简单的方法是——打开控制面板,搜索“ODBC”,点进去后找到“驱动程序”这一栏,看看里面有没有包含“Sybase”或者“Adaptive Server Enterprise”字样。
- 如果没有,那就得去Sybase官网下载对应版本的驱动,根据你的系统(32位或64位)来选。有些公司的IT部门会统一安装,遇到不确定的情况可以问问。
- 安装完毕后,建议重启下电脑,再去ODBC管理器里刷新查看。
- 如果还是不确定安装对了没,可以在Excel里尝试“数据-自其他来源-从ODBC”,看看能不能选中Sybase相关选项。
驱动这步其实很关键,装错了或者没装,就算后面配置再对也没法连上。如果大家在这步还遇到具体的报错,欢迎评论区交流。如果你觉得ODBC配置麻烦,其实现在有些低代码工具(比如简道云)可以直接对接数据库,流程更简单,推荐试试: 简道云在线试用:www.jiandaoyun.com 。
2. Excel连接Sybase后,怎么批量导入或导出数据?有哪些容易踩的坑?
很多新手朋友学会了Excel和Sybase数据库的连接之后,下一步往往会遇到“如何批量导入/导出数据”。特别是数据量大的时候,Excel自带的功能有时候会出问题,或者速度很慢。有没有什么高效的办法?有哪些容易忽略的小细节?
这个问题问得特别好!我刚入门那会儿也被批量数据导入/导出卡住过,分享下我的实操经验:
- 批量导入:Excel本身可以通过“数据-自其他来源-ODBC”直接把Sybase的数据拉进来,但如果数据表特别大,建议分批导入。一次拉太多容易死机或者报错。可以先筛选部分数据再导入。
- 批量导出:把Excel数据反向导入Sybase就得用一些辅助工具,比如Sybase自带的“bcp”命令行工具,或者用第三方ETL工具(如DataGrip、Navicat)。这些工具支持直接读写Excel文件,更稳定。
- 易踩的坑:字符编码问题很常见,导出后中文乱码;数据格式不匹配,数字列和文本列混用会报错;数据量太大时Excel可能直接崩溃,建议分批操作。
- 如果是经常要做数据同步,建议写个小脚本自动化处理,比如用Python的pandas和pyodbc库,效率高还可以定时同步。
- 个人觉得,Excel适合做一些轻量的数据操作,大批量还是数据库工具更靠谱。如果你想要更自动化的同步方式,也可以考虑简道云这类工具,支持多数据源集成,效率高不少。
大家有具体需求也可以留言,我可以帮你分析下适合哪种方案。
3. Excel连接Sybase数据库时,怎么保证数据安全?有哪些权限设置要注意?
不少公司出于安全考虑,对数据库的访问权限控制得很严格。用Excel连接Sybase数据库,担心一不小心把数据暴露了、或者误操作导致数据被删掉。有哪些安全措施和权限设置,是必须要关注和提前配置的?
很理解大家的担心,毕竟数据库里的数据一旦泄露或者误删,后果挺严重。我平时连接Sybase数据库时,主要会注意以下几点:
- 数据库账号权限设置:建议让IT或者DBA专门给Excel用的账号,分配只读权限。这样即使操作失误,也不会更改或删除数据。
- 网络安全:连接Sybase数据库建议用VPN或在内网环境操作,避免数据在外网传输被截获。
- Excel本身的安全性:尽量不要把数据库连接串写在明文文档里,可以用密码管理器或者加密分发方式。
- 日志审计:让DBA开启数据库操作日志,这样一旦有异常操作可以追踪。
- 数据脱敏:如果Excel导出的是敏感数据,建议先做脱敏处理,再分发到其他部门。
- 定期更换数据库连接密码,防止长期暴露。
这些措施虽然看起来繁琐,但真的能减少很多安全隐患。大家在实际操作时也可以根据公司要求做调整。如果你是新手,不太会配置权限,建议找DBA帮忙一起搞定,千万别直接用超级管理员账号连接数据库!
4. Excel连接Sybase数据库失败,常见的报错有哪些?怎么排查解决?
不少朋友在实际操作过程中,Excel连接Sybase数据库总是遇到报错,比如“连接超时”、“找不到数据源”、“无法识别驱动”等。每次一出错就很头大,不知道该从哪一步开始排查。有没有一份实用的排错指南?
这个问题真的很实用!我自己经常帮同事排查Excel连数据库的各种错误,可以总结一下常见的几种情况和解决办法:
- 驱动未安装或版本不对:最常见的就是ODBC驱动缺失或者装错了。可以去控制面板的ODBC管理器里看一眼,装对了没。
- 数据源名称(DSN)配置错误:Excel连接时要用到DSN,名字必须和ODBC配置一致,否则会报“找不到数据源”。
- 用户名、密码输错:有时候密码改了忘记同步,Excel会报认证失败。
- 网络不通:公司内网断了,或者防火墙拦截了Sybase端口(默认5000、4100等),Excel怎么都连不上。
- 数据库权限不足:如果用的是只读账号,但表结构有变动,可能会报“权限不足”之类的错。
- Excel自身问题:版本太老,或者系统是64位但装了32位驱动,兼容性会有问题。
排查建议按照“驱动-DSN-账号-网络-权限”的顺序来一步步检查,基本能解决大部分问题。如果实在搞不定,记得把错误信息和截图发出来,大家一起帮你分析。多交流真的很有用!
5. 除了Excel,还有哪些工具可以更好地对接Sybase数据库,适合新手操作?
很多人用Excel操作数据库,是因为习惯了表格界面,但实际工作中发现Excel有不少限制,比如数据量大时速度慢、功能有限。有没有更适合新手的工具可以替代Excel,既能对接Sybase,又简单易用?
这个话题我很有感触!自己以前也是纯靠Excel,后来发现其实有不少更适合新手的工具:
- 数据库客户端工具,比如Navicat、DBeaver、DataGrip。这些都支持Sybase数据库连接,界面和Excel有点像,但功能更强大,支持批量编辑、SQL查询、数据结构管理。
- 低代码平台,比如简道云,可以直接对接数据库,数据可视化和流程处理都很方便,几乎不用写代码,适合新手和业务人员。如果你对数据集成和自动化有需求,强烈推荐试试: 简道云在线试用:www.jiandaoyun.com 。
- Python和R等数据分析工具,虽然需要点编程基础,但处理数据更灵活,适合做复杂分析。
- Power BI、Tableau等数据可视化工具,也能对接Sybase,适合做报表和图形展示。
总的来说,如果只是简单的数据查询和导出,Excel够用;但数据量大或者需要自动化,建议用数据库客户端或低代码平台。工具选对了,效率真的能提升不少!如果你想了解具体操作流程,可以留言,我会继续分享。

